Maintainer: Debian Install System Team <debian-boot@lists.debian.org> Architecture: all Version: 2.53.102.53.10 Debian base system configurator Problem: I've just update and upgraded apt. The results from apt-get upgrade were: Reading Package Lists... Done Building Dependency Tree... Done The following packages have been kept back: base-config 0 upgraded, 0 newly installed, 0 to remove and 1 not upgraded. I apt-get dist-upgraded and the output was: Reading Package Lists... Done Building Dependency Tree... Done Calculating Upgrade... Done The following packages have been kept back: base-config 0 upgraded, 0 newly installed, 0 to remove and 1 not upgraded. I apt-get installed base-config and the output was: Reading Package Lists... Done Building Dependency Tree... Done The following packages will be REMOVED: tasksel The following packages will be upgraded: base-config 1 upgraded, 0 newly installed, 1 to remove and 0 not upgraded. Finally, i apt-get'd install tasksel base-config Reading Package Lists... Done Building Dependency Tree... Done tasksel is already the newest version. Some packages could not be installed. This may mean that you have requested an impossible situation or if you are using the unstable distribution that some required packages have not yet been created or been moved out of Incoming. The following information may help to resolve the situation: The following packages have unmet dependencies: base-config: Conflicts: tasksel (< 2.25) but 2.24 is to be installed E: Broken packages I am running testing and it seems that base-config is conflicting with tasksel.
